Troubleshooting

21

Noise, Static, Interference or Other Calls

Heard while Using the Handset:

• Try changing channels.
• Make sure the base antenna is in an

upright position.
• Make sure you are in the usable

range of the base station.
• Make sure the handset battery is

fully charged.
• Try relocating the base unit to

another location.
• Make sure the AC Adapter is not

plugged into the wall outlet with

other appliances.
• Try relocating the base unit to

another location.

Phone Will Not Hold Charge:

• Make sure the charging contacts on

the handset and base are free of dust

and dirt. Clean the contacts with a

soft cloth.
• Make sure CHARGE LED on the base

is lit when handset is in the cradle.
• If necessary, replace the handset

battery. (See Handset Battery Charging)

Difficulty in Placing or Receiving Calls:

• Move closer to the base and

try again.
• If moving closer does not work, you

may have lost the security code.
• Reset code by placing the handset

back on the base for 5-10 seconds.

(See Security Code Section)
• Make sure you have selected the

correct dialing mode, tone or pulse.
• Make sure the AC Adapter is not

plugged into a wall outlet with other

appliances. Disconnect for 5-10

seconds then reconnect. Place the

handset back on the base and

reinsert the AC Adapter.
• Make sure the handset battery is

fully charged.
